 MAGIC The Gathering: Mirrodin
Mirrodin is the next standalone set after the Onslaught block and is the first set to contain 306 cards instead of the previous 350.
Mirrodin features a brand new story line and will take place in a new setting for Magic (in what appears to be a dark, almost futuristic world).
Mirrodin offers you an artifact rich environment never seen before in the game of Magic.

 Essential Magic - Cardset Overview   (Site not responding. Last check: 2007-11-06)
Mirrodin booster packs each contain 11 commons, 3 uncommons, 1 rare, and no lands.
The all-metal theme of the Mirrodin storyline is reflected in the set itself by the fact that almost half the cards are Artifacts.
